Uses of Interface
org.springframework.cloud.vault.config.SecretBackendMetadata
-
-
Uses of SecretBackendMetadata in org.springframework.cloud.vault.config
Subinterfaces of SecretBackendMetadata in org.springframework.cloud.vault.config Modifier and Type Interface Description interfaceLeasingSecretBackendMetadataLease extension toSecretBackendMetadataproviding alease mode.Classes in org.springframework.cloud.vault.config that implement SecretBackendMetadata Modifier and Type Class Description classKeyValueSecretBackendMetadataSecretBackendMetadatafor thekv(key-value) secret backend.classSecretBackendMetadataSupportSupport class forSecretBackendMetadataimplementations.classSecretBackendMetadataWrapperProvides a convenient implementation of theSecretBackendMetadatainterface that can be subclassed to override specific methods.Methods in org.springframework.cloud.vault.config that return SecretBackendMetadata Modifier and Type Method Description static SecretBackendMetadataKeyValueSecretBackendMetadata. create(String path)static SecretBackendMetadataKeyValueSecretBackendMetadata. create(String secretBackendPath, String key)static SecretBackendMetadataKeyValueSecretBackendMetadata. create(String path, org.springframework.vault.core.util.PropertyTransformer propertyTransformer)SecretBackendMetadataSecretBackendMetadataFactory. createMetadata(T backendDescriptor)Converts aVaultSecretBackendDescriptorinto aSecretBackendMetadata.SecretBackendMetadataVaultConfigLocation. getSecretBackendMetadata()Methods in org.springframework.cloud.vault.config that return types with arguments of type SecretBackendMetadata Modifier and Type Method Description Collection<SecretBackendMetadata>PropertySourceLocatorConfiguration. getSecretBackends()Methods in org.springframework.cloud.vault.config with parameters of type SecretBackendMetadata Modifier and Type Method Description SecretBackendConfigurerSecretBackendConfigurer. add(SecretBackendMetadata metadata)Add aSecretBackendMetadata.protected abstract org.springframework.core.env.PropertySource<?>VaultPropertySourceLocatorSupport. createVaultPropertySource(SecretBackendMetadata accessor)CreateVaultPropertySourceinitialized with aSecretBackendMetadata.SecretsVaultConfigOperations. read(SecretBackendMetadata secretBackendMetadata)Read secrets from a secret backend encapsulated within aSecretBackendMetadata.SecretsVaultConfigTemplate. read(SecretBackendMetadata secretBackendMetadata)Constructors in org.springframework.cloud.vault.config with parameters of type SecretBackendMetadata Constructor Description SecretBackendMetadataWrapper(SecretBackendMetadata delegate)Create a newSecretBackendMetadataWrappergivenSecretBackendMetadata.VaultConfigLocation(SecretBackendMetadata secretBackendMetadata, boolean optional)Create a newVaultConfigLocationinstance.
-